How much time outside of class would I need to spend working on APUSH, APCSP, and precalculus? by boxedupandsent42 in APStudents

[–]some_future_seeker 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I took both APUSH & AP CSP junior year, & Pre-Cal my senior year this year. APUSH went fine for me, as my teacher was very good with having us learn the material. Only problem I had was my teacher never assigned dbq's or leq's, just saq's. I only practiced dbq's about 2 weeks before the exam (never did an leq before the exam) & got a 4. CSP was okay for me, since I got to build my own project. I only got a 3 on the exam but, that was due to some family issues I was dealing with at the time. Pre-Cal exam wasn't too bad this year but, for me it forced me to study more than I normally do for a math class (which could just be my experience). I don't suggest putting this class off until the last minute since its harder to catch up compared to APUSH & CSP. I would say that between these classes you would need to dedicate 2- 2 1/2 hours per a day, maybe less.
